Solid Process Redo

I've been asked to look at the current Solid Team process and suggest an overhaul to reflect the current process.

Changes are made in the pull request, but for easy reading, I'll also list them here:

High-Level Changes

  • All Solid Team "Teams" have been reorganized into one of four "Committees":
    • Administrators
    • Code of Conduct
    • Dei
    • Editors
  • I suggest members of every committee have been reset. We will go about the process of re-appointing them from scratch at the next meeting.

Removals:

  • Librarians: role lacked a proper description.
  • Notification Panel: This is an innappropriate place for the notifications panel
  • Repo Overview: It did not reflect the current state of the github.com/solid organization.
  • Creators: The creator role has been merged with administrators. For the most part, website updates are just updating things like the "apps" and "stakeholders." If we ever need a complete site overhaul, we can create a special committee to do that. Otherwise, this falls under the perview of the day-to-day administrator operations.
  • Draft working charter: We now have a new repo for that
  • Test-suite-panel: It should have its own repo

Todo:

  • Elect new active members for each category
